Abstract
The electric breakdown field of plasma polymer films was studied by applying rectangular voltage pulses. The breakdown field increases by the incorporation of fluorine atoms into the film when the pulse width is shorter than 5 μs. This is due to the scattering of electronic carriers caused by C-F bonds.
